Scope and Contents This tan leather notebook contains Charles Lyell's notes from his North American tour of New York, including New York City, Albany, Syracuse, Rochester. Notes are predominantly pencil, some ink, a mixture of field notes and travel notes. The index is located at the back of the notebook, both covers are unmarked. Scope and Contents This notebook contains notes by Charles Lyell from his travels in Albany, New Jersey, and Philadelphia, Pennsylvania. Notes are mostly pencil, occasional ink. Covers are both blank, indexes are located in the back of the notebook.
